What Is Required for Successful Heat Treatment
Successful heat treatment for bed bug eradication requires careful preparation and the right equipment. Necessary tools consist of high-capacity heaters able to reach temperatures surpassing 120°F, which is essential for destroying bed bugs at every stage of their life cycle. Thermal imaging devices can assist in locating thermal discrepancies, confirming that every area is properly heated. Additionally, fans are necessary to circulate hot air effectively, promoting uniform temperature distribution throughout the treated space.
Safety equipment, like protective gloves and masks, is important for personal safety during the treatment process. Precise temperature monitoring devices, like temperature sensors, allow for careful measurement of heat levels in various locations. A reliable power source is essential, as heat treatment may necessitate extended periods of operation. Finally, adequate insulation of the treatment areas works to maintain elevated temperatures for extended periods, boosting treatment success. When properly prepared and equipped, the probability of complete bed bug removal significantly improve.
Identifying Bed Bug Hiding Spots in Your Home
Where could bed bugs be hiding in a home? These parasites are infamous for their skill at secreting themselves in a range of spots. Typical hiding places include the seams and creases of mattresses and box springs, where they are able to feed on resting residents. Bed frames and headboards likewise act as suitable refuges, commonly sheltering eggs and nymphs within their crevices.
Apart from bedding, bed bugs may inhabit furniture, particularly padded furnishings such as settees and seating. They can also crawl into crevices within walls, baseboards, or flooring. Cluttered areas, including closets and nightstands, create ideal conditions for these bugs to multiply.
Routine checks of these areas can assist in detecting infestations at an early stage. Residents should remain alert, carefully inspecting any areas of concern and using a flashlight to enhance their view. Being aware of where bed bugs tend to conceal themselves is key to managing them effectively.
Performing Heat Treatment: Step-by-Step Instructions
A systematic approach to heat treatment can effectively eradicate bed bugs from infested spaces. The method commences with a detailed evaluation to establish the severity of the infestation and the exact locations demanding treatment. Following this, all objects in the treated space should be cleared or shielded to avoid heat escape. The interior temperature should be increased to no less than 120°F (49°C) through the use of dedicated heaters, making certain that heat is distributed consistently throughout the room.
Monitoring equipment should be installed to track thermal readings, as uniformity in temperature is vital for optimal results. Once the target temperature is reached and maintained for at least 90 minutes, the process may be regarded as effective. Following the treatment, the area should be allowed to cool slowly, and a follow-up examination performed to verify the eradication of bed bugs. As a final step, any residual items must be treated or disposed of to eliminate the risk of re-infestation, ensuring a thorough approach to bed bug eradication.

How Long Does It Take for Heat Treatment to Eradicate Bed Bugs?
Heat treatment typically takes around six to eight hours to effectively eliminate bed bugs. The time required may vary based on the infested area's size and the equipment used during the extermination process.
Do My Belongings Experience Any Side Effects from Heat Treatment?
Heat treatment has the potential to harm sensitive items, including artwork, electronics, and plastics, as a result of high temperatures. That said, most household items, especially fabrics and hard materials, generally endure the process with no significant damage or lasting impact.

What Temperature Is Necessary to Kill Bed Bugs Effectively?
To effectively kill bed bugs, the temperature must achieve a minimum of 118°F (48°C) over an extended duration. Elevated heat levels, around 130°F (54°C), can provide quicker results, confirming the thorough extermination of every life stage.
